There is a thing called paraneoplasia. This is where a cancer is causing the nerve problems...along with other things:

Blood work is called a paraneoplastic panel.

Some of the chemo agents are also triggers for Charcot Marie Tooth patients. Some CMT patients luck out and can be latent with it, until a round of chemo sets it off. This is due to the drugs but not the same as paraneoplasia.
